Security Mutual Life’s Guerriero elected secretary of Society of FSP

BINGHAMTON, N.Y. — Ernie Guerriero, VP of marketing at Security Mutual Life, was elected secretary of the Society of Financial Service Professionals (FSP) at the organization’s Aug. 7 annual meeting.  His position is for the 2020 — 2021 term and went into effect on Sept. 1. Gilligan joins OCRRA board of directors

SALINA — OCRRA (Onondaga County Resource Recovery Agency) announced it has appointed Eileen D. Gilligan, of Lafayette, to its board of directors. Gilligan has more than 30 years of experience as a consulting geologist and has worked on numerous groundwater, surface water, and air-contaminant projects.
